Use

In this IMG activity, you can define new basic rules in addition to the basic rules delivered. In the next activity, you use these basic rules to define collection rules.

The conditions defined in the basic rules are used for prioritization in the consideration of business partners in SAP Collections Management. If a condition (for example, amount of receivables due from a business partner) is fulfilled, the priority in the worklist increases accordingly.

Requirements

If you want to implement new basic rules, you define whether parameters (for example, amount interval, number of days) are relevant for the basic rule and if so, which ones. If the basic rule is to have parameters, in the ABAP Dictionary define

  • A data element for each selection option (as long as one does not already exist)
  • A structure that contains these data elements.

Standard settings

The SAP standard contains several basic rules that can be used to define collection rules.

Activities

If you want to create a new basic rule, you have to perform the following steps:

  1. Assign a technical name in the customer name range to the basic rule and enter an explanatory text.
  2. If the basic rule has selection conditions, define the related structure. In the view Attributes of Selection Options for Basic Rules, define how the use is to see the selection condition (full selection condition, single field selection, simple interval, or parameter).
  3. Implement the basic rule. For more information, see the basic rules BAdI.
